#6e191d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e191d is composed of 43.1% red, 9.8%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.3% magenta, 73.6%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 357.2 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 26.5%. #6e191d color hex could be obtained by blending #dc323a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#6e191d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e191d has RGB values of R:110, G:25,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.74,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 7215389.

Shades and Tints of #6e191d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0304 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#6e191d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444343 is the less saturated color, while #83040a is the most saturated one.
